在互联网的无垠天地中,每一处网站都拥有其独一无二的标识——网址或域名。然而,你是否曾好奇,当你轻触键盘输入网址后,它是怎样被转化为服务器的IP地址,进而展现出网页内容的呢?这背后离不开一位默默无闻的英雄——域名服务器(DNS)。那么,这位英雄究竟承担着怎样的职责呢?让我们一同揭开它的神秘面纱。
要理解域名服务器的角色,首先需明晰域名与IP地址的关系。域名,如“www.example.com”,是为了便于人们记忆而设计的;而计算机网络中的设备则通过IP地址,如“192.0.2.1”,来相互识别和通信。域名服务器的核心使命,便是将人类易于理解的域名翻译成机器能够读懂的IP地址,这一过程被称作“域名解析”。
设想一下,当你在浏览器中键入网址并按下回车,你的电脑会向本地域名服务器发出询问,请求该域名对应的IP地址。若本地服务器已对该域名有所了解,它会迅速给出答案;否则,它会代表你向上级域名服务器发起查询,直至寻得答案。一旦手握IP地址,你的电脑便能与目标服务器成功对接,获取网页数据,呈现在你的眼前。
域名服务器的职责不仅限于域名解析。它还肩负着维护互联网上域名信息的重任。这些信息如同全球分布的数据库中的记录,每当有新域名诞生或现有域名信息变动时,相应的更新都会在域名服务器上得以体现,确保所有人都能访问到最新、最准确的信息。
此外,域名服务器还是网络安全的第一道屏障。通过部署诸如拒绝服务攻击防护、缓存投毒检测等安全策略,它能有效抵御恶意活动的侵扰。同时,借助负载均衡技术,域名服务器还能优化网站的访问速度与稳定性,为用户带来更加流畅的浏览体验。
综上所述,域名服务器在互联网架构中占据着举足轻重的地位。它不仅是简单的转换工具,更是保障网络顺畅运行、信息安全及用户体验优化的关键所在。虽然我们在日常上网时鲜少直接与域名服务器打交道,但它却在幕后无声地支撑着整个互联网的运转,让我们的数字生活因之而变得更加便捷与安全。